Reconstructive surgery in Antalya typically costs from $3,200 to $6,500. The final price depends on the specific technique, case complexity, and clinic accreditation. Patients save around 80% compared to the US, where this procedure costs $30,000 on average. Most Antalya clinics provide all-inclusive packages covering preoperative tests, surgical fees, hospital stays, hotel accommodation, and VIP transfers.
